Ingredients of Kalakand

  1. Prepare 1 of lt full fat milk.
  2. You need 1 cup of dust sugar.
  3. Prepare 1 teaspoon of cardamom powder.
  4. It's 1 tablespoon of condense milk.
  5. You need 2 tablespoon of lemon juice.
  6. It's 1 teaspoon of crushed almonds.

Kalakand instructions

  1. At first to make the Chena take a pan and boil the milk. Once get boiled then add the lemon juice and make the Chena. Immediately wash the Chena in cold water and squeeze it in a clean cotton peice of cloth.
  2. Take a pan add the Chena and sugar stir it well soon it will loose moisture keep stiring then add the condense milk and the cardmom powder..
  3. Keep stiring untill it becomes thik and compact. After it cools down cut into square peice and garnish with broken almonds.
